Multiple Disabilities (MD)

A butterfly with the words: imagine the possibilities.

Multiple Disabilities (MD) means two or more impairments at the same time (for example, intellectual disability with blindness, specific learning disability with orthopedic impairment), the combination of which causes such severe educational needs that they cannot be accommodated in special education programs solely for one of the impairments. The term does not include deaf-blindness.
